Lemuria Land is a captivating animal park located in Hell-Ville, Madagascar, offering visitors a unique opportunity to encounter the island's famous lemurs in their natural habitat. Explore lush landscapes and engage with these fascinating creatures, making it a must-visit for animal lovers and adventure seekers alike.

Know before you go
Hi, I'm Eve. Here are a few practical things to know before exploring Lemuria Land.
- Visit early in the morning to see the lemurs most active and energetic.
- Bring a camera to capture the playful antics of the lemurs in their natural environment.
- Wear comfortable shoes suitable for walking on uneven terrain throughout the park.
- Check for any special feeding times or educational talks scheduled during your visit.
- Consider visiting on a weekday to avoid larger crowds and enjoy a more intimate experience.
